Nolyn Pointe's pricing right now is being set by a thin pool of activity — just four closings inform this snapshot, so the median of $518,000 should be read as a directional marker rather than a tight band. At $188.31 per square foot, condition and finish level are likely doing more work to explain price spread than any single feature of the community itself.
A median of 49 days on market suggests these homes are not moving on the first weekend, but they are not sitting stale either — this reads as a market where correctly priced listings still find buyers within a normal selling cycle. With so few closings to draw from, both buyers and sellers should treat any one comparable with some caution and lean on a broker who is tracking the pipeline in real time, not just the last reported sale.

The Nolyn Pointe buying strategy.
If we were buying in Nolyn Pointe today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.
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.
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.
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.
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

Reading a small sample honestly
With only four closings feeding this window, Nolyn Pointe is not a community where you can point to a tidy price-per-square-foot curve and call it settled. The $188.31 median per-square-foot figure is a real data point, but it represents whatever mix of condition, size, and finish happened to close recently — not necessarily what the next listing will command.
No community amenities are identified in current MLS listings, which means value here is likely tied to the home itself and its location within Atlanta rather than to shared recreational features. Buyers evaluating Nolyn Pointe should treat each listing on its own merits and confirm current condition and any lot-specific factors directly, rather than assuming a package of amenities that isn't showing up in the data.
